Flax Art Studios Curator in Residence
Flax Art Studios are looking to support early career or freelance curators.
What we offer:
We will provide free workspace for two curators to use as a base as they develop their curatorial practice at our new home at Havelock House (former UTV Television Studios).
They will have the opportunity to work within and be part of our exciting new city centre studio space along with 50 contemporary visual artists, our Emerging artist hub, large wood workshop, casting/plaster workshop, outside workplace, photographic studio, film studio, computer/Internet desk space, soundproof recording spaces & on-site secure carpark spaces.
In return we ask the curators to engage with our studio artists in curating a new programme of ‘Test Works’, In which artists and curators can utilise the building and our array of different spaces to test out new work ideas, screenings, performances, etc. This will cumulate in one-off events open to the public, helping us further support and promote contemporary visual art in Northern Ireland.
The curators are also welcome to develop their own projects engaging with the space.
Access: 8am to 8pm – 7 days a week
Duration: 6 months
